Hideous ghost won't stop flushing pub loo

Okay ... I admit to being disturbed by this one ... but then who wouldn't be .... if there is one place on Earth we wish to be left alone it's got to be the loo!

GHOST-hunter Darren Johnson-Smith makes no bones about it: the paranormal tale of the Low Valley apparition that scared the life out of a Barnsley pub landlord is one of the best he's ever heard.

Paranormal investigator Darren went to the Low Valley Arms in Wombwell when he heard that landlord Roger Froggatt had confronted a ghostly woman in white with half her face missing - and police backed up his story.

Roger, aged 49, said he felt fear like never before, as he was hunting for what he feared was a burglar in the early hours.
He came face-to-face with a grotesquely disfigured woman dressed in white.

Roger was speechless with shock and his wife Kathryn called the police, believing he had confronted an intruder.
Officers found no signs of entry, although the alarms had been tripped and all the TVs had been turned on.

Officers were left shaken and baffled by a toilet in the ladies, repeatedly flushing by itself.

Darren, who runs Steel City Ghost Tours, said: "Usually I wouldn't be interested. There are a lot of pubs that have their own ghosts. But the flushing of the toilets witnessed by two police officers makes it.
"I know Roger saw something and the police back up his story. This is not made up.

"It is one of the first times I have known an apparition do something physical. This is not some half-asleep person who has had a dream. It's one of the best, if not the best, paranormal incidents I have heard of.
"With the building being refurbished the owners have been through a stressful period. The spirit has picked up on it and followed the track of it and manifested itself in the toilet."

Darren spent yesterday performing a meditation in the toilet and came up with a name for the lady: Mary Quantrill.

He claimed she was an early 19th century traveller, murdered by a man with a hoe, on or near the site of the pub.

Kathryn said a police officer asked; 'Is your toilet supposed to flush itself on its own?'

The handle was going up and down of its own accord, and the bowl filling and overflowing. Officers could not find an explanation. It went on until 5am.

Kathryn said: "The police wanted to call an ambulance for Roger because he was in deep shock. They said they'd never seen anyone so scared.
"But they looked a bit shaken themselves after we witnessed the toilet flushing itself. I even lifted the lid on the cistern but there was nothing to see. I didn't feel too scared because I was with two police officers."

It is the culmination of a string of spooky incidents in their year in the pub. Barrels have been heard moving in the cellar, bottles have smashed, the fridge defrosted while switched on and the gas pressure has inexplicably failed several times. There are regular cold spots, mostly in the toilets.

Roger, a former steel erector, had been sceptical about ghosts until he faced with one.

Wringing his hands, he said: "I'm a level-headed man and nothing like this has ever happened to me before. This was the single most terrifying experience of my life."

A police spokesman said: "Officers saw the toilet flushing but could not explain it."
